silver spoon  
n.  Inherited wealth.

[From the phrase born with a silver spoon in one's mouth, wealthy from birth.]

Main Entry:  silver spoon
Part of Speech:  n
Definition:  inherited wealth and accompanying social status and (sometimes) luck
Etymology:  1859-64
